The statute allows the transfer “when the President directs,” so it can be used in a declared war, an undeclared conflict, or even a national emergency if the President deems it necessary for naval operations (e.g., to integrate Coast Guard cutters, aircraft, and personnel into Navy fleet operations in the Persian Gulf or Strait of Hormuz). The Coast Guard’s law-enforcement and maritime-interdiction capabilities would then operate under full Navy command.
